titleOfInvention |
Method for producing optical element with stabilized refractive index profile using polymer mixture |
abstract |
PROBLEM TO BE SOLVED: A method for manufacturing an optical element, wherein a first monomer is polymerized to form a first polymer having a degree of cure that varies spatially so as to obtain a predetermined refractive index profile; Polymerizing the second monomer in the presence of the first polymer such that the polymer is incorporated into the first polymer, the second polymer stabilizing the first polymer and the refractive index profile, To do. Used to prepare eyeglass lenses for correcting human eyes. [Selection] Figure 1a |
